Sidney Frederick Livingstone (born 29 March 1945) is an English stage, television, and film character actor. He has sometimes been credited as Sydney Livingstone.
Sidney Livingstone. Actor: Lifeforce. Born in Rochdale he was an apprentice chef, salesman, plumber's merchant and engineer before he followed his ambition to act and joined the Guildhall School of Music and Drama.

Sidney Livingstone (born 29th March 1945 in Rochdale) appeared on Coronation Street in three roles: Mark Brittain Warehouse storeman Bob Skelton in May 1971. Roy Thornley, business associate at Sylvia's Separates and seducer of the nineteen-year old Gail Potter, appearing between April and September 1976. A stone cladding workman in February 1989.
